Understanding Air-Powered Hardwood Floor Nailers

Alright, let’s break it down. An air powered hardwood floor nailer is your trusty sidekick in the flooring universe. It’s a tool that uses compressed air to drive nails into your hardwood planks with remarkable precision. Think of it as a superhero, swooping in to ensure each nail goes exactly where it needs to, securing your floor with unmatched efficiency. There are a few types of these nailers, from manual trigger models to those that fire a nail as soon as you position them – talk about convenience!

Factors to Consider When Choosing an Air Powered Hardwood Floor Nailer

Before you go on a nailer shopping spree, let’s chat about a few things you need to keep in mind. First, nail gauge and size – ensure your nailer can handle the size of nails your flooring requires. Also, consider the air pressure it needs – you’ll need a trusty air compressor to keep things running smoothly. And hey, don’t forget about adjustability. Different floors have different thicknesses, so having a nailer that can adapt is like having a tool that speaks the language of your floor.

Expert Tips for Successful Hardwood Floor Installation

Alright, gather ’round for some golden nuggets of wisdom. First, let your hardwood planks get cozy with your space’s humidity levels before installing – it’s like a woodsy spa day for them. Prep your subfloor and ensure it’s level – you want your planks to have a solid foundation. And remember, leave room for expansion – it’s like giving your floor some breathing space.
